How Does Land Clearing Enhance Site Development Efficiency?
Proper land clearing improves efficiency by opening safe, workable space for equipment and crews. Removing trees and debris reduces hazards, makes mobilization faster, and allows precise layout and earthwork to follow. The result is a cleaner schedule and fewer site delays.
What Excavation Techniques Are Used by Destin Contractors?
Destin contractors choose excavation methods based on project goals and site conditions. Common techniques include:
- Trenching: For running utilities and drainage lines.
- Bulk Excavation: Moving large volumes of earth for foundations or base areas.
- Grading: Fine‑tuning slopes and elevations to meet design and drainage needs.
Each technique is applied with an eye toward safety, accuracy, and long‑term performance.
How Do Grading and Drainage Solutions Impact Site Stability in Destin, Florida?
Grading and drainage are critical in Destin, Florida, because managing water protects both structures and soil. Proper slopes and drainage systems direct runoff away from buildings, reduce erosion, and help prevent settlement. Given Florida’s variable soils, tailored compaction and stabilization practices are often necessary to maintain stability.
Knowing local soil behavior is fundamental to successful sitework and long‑term site performance.

What Are the Best Practices for Effective Grading in Destin?
Best practices for grading in Destin include:
- Soil Testing: Identify composition and bearing capacity before you move dirt.
- Proper Drainage Planning: Design slopes and conveyance so water runs away from structures.
- Use of Quality Equipment: Modern machines and experienced operators improve accuracy and speed.
Following these steps reduces risk and helps projects move from rough grading to final grades without costly rework.
How Is Drainage Managed to Comply with Florida Regulations?
Drainage systems in Florida must follow local and state rules to protect waterways and reduce flooding. Common solutions include:
- Retention and Detention Ponds: Structures that control stormwater volume and release.
- Permeable Surfaces: Materials that allow infiltration and reduce runoff.
Careful design and permitting ensure drainage systems meet code and protect surrounding properties and ecosystems.
What Are the Distinct Requirements for Commercial Site Development in Destin, FL?
Commercial development in Destin typically requires:
- Zoning Compliance: Confirming the land use aligns with local ordinances.
- Environmental Assessments: Evaluating impacts on wetlands, habitats, and stormwater.
- Infrastructure Planning: Designing access roads, parking, utilities, and stormwater systems to support operations.
Meeting these requirements early avoids delays and keeps projects moving toward occupancy.
How Do Commercial Projects Differ from Residential Sitework?
Commercial projects differ mainly in scale, complexity, and regulatory scrutiny. They often need larger earthwork volumes, heavier infrastructure, and more detailed coordination with agencies and utility providers. Timelines and budgets reflect that complexity, so early planning and experienced partners are essential.
What Permitting and Regulatory Compliance Are Essential in Florida?
Essential permits and approvals include:
- Building Permits: Required for most construction activities to ensure safety and code compliance.
- Environmental Permits: Needed when work affects wetlands, shorelines, or protected areas.
- Zoning Approvals: Confirming the proposed use aligns with local land‑use plans.
Navigating permitting efficiently helps avoid costly hold‑ups and keeps projects on schedule.
